Clearlake, situated in Skagit County, Washington, is a quaint residential community that offers a delightful mixture of natural beauty, tranquility, and modern amenities. Known for its proximity to the stunning Skagit Valley, Clearlake features charming neighborhoods with easy access to outdoor activities, local parks, and community services. This article explores the best residential areas in Clearlake, highlighting their unique characteristics, housing options, and average prices to help potential residents make informed decisions.

    Clearlake Heights



    Clearlake Heights

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Clearlake Heights is a peaceful neighborhood known for its stunning views of the surrounding mountains and lakes. The area is primarily residential, attracting families and retirees looking for a tranquil lifestyle away from the hustle and bustle.



    Characteristics of the Clearlake Heights

    * Culture: Family-oriented community with local events and gatherings

    * Transportation: Primarily car-dependent, close proximity to main roads

    * Services: Local grocery store, community center, and parks nearby

    * Environment: Quiet and serene with a strong sense of community


    Housing Options in the Clearlake Heights

    Single-family homes, Townhouses


    Average Home Prices in the Clearlake Heights

    * Buying: $350,000 – $450,000

    * Renting: $1,600 – $2,200/month



    Rural Clearlake



    Rural Clearlake

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    This area encompasses the more rural sections of Clearlake, featuring larger lots and a variety of housing options. It's ideal for individuals looking for spacious living and an agricultural lifestyle while being close to town.



    Characteristics of the Rural Clearlake

    * Culture: Rural lifestyle with agricultural communities

    * Transportation: Car essential, limited public transport options

    * Services: Farmer's markets, local farms, and stores

    * Environment: Spacious, peaceful, and connected with nature


    Housing Options in the Rural Clearlake

    Acreage properties, Custom-built homes


    Average Home Prices in the Rural Clearlake

    * Buying: $400,000 – $600,000

    * Renting: $1,800 – $2,500/month



    Clearlake Village



    Clearlake Village

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Clearlake Village offers a vibrant community atmosphere with easy access to local shops and dining. The neighborhood is perfect for those who enjoy being centrally located while still having access to outdoor activities.



    Characteristics of the Clearlake Village

    * Culture: Community events, local shops, and restaurants

    * Transportation: Walkable with public transportation options available

    * Services: Grocery stores, cafes, and medical facilities nearby

    * Environment: Lively with a mix of urban and suburban vibes


    Housing Options in the Clearlake Village

    Condos, Single-family homes


    Average Home Prices in the Clearlake Village

    * Buying: $325,000 – $450,000

    * Renting: $1,500 – $2,000/month



    Lakefront Estates



    Lakefront Estates

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Lakefront Estates features luxurious homes located on the shores of the local reservoir. This area appeals to buyers seeking a vacation home vibe or a permanent residence with beautiful water views.



    Characteristics of the Lakefront Estates

    * Culture: Water sports, fishing, and outdoor recreation

    * Transportation: Car preferred, access to scenic drives

    * Services: Marinas, boat rentals, and waterfront dining

    * Environment: Relaxed, scenic, and recreational


    Housing Options in the Lakefront Estates

    Waterfront properties, Luxury homes


    Average Home Prices in the Lakefront Estates

    * Buying: $600,000 – $900,000

    * Renting: $2,500 – $4,000/month



    Clearlake Park



    Clearlake Park

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Clearlake Park is a neighborhood renowned for its parks and recreational areas. It's an excellent choice for families who enjoy outdoor activities and local community events.



    Characteristics of the Clearlake Park

    * Culture: Active lifestyle with many family-oriented events

    * Transportation: Easily accessible via car and some public options

    * Services: Parks, playgrounds, and sports facilities nearby

    * Environment: Family-friendly, vibrant, and engaging


    Housing Options in the Clearlake Park

    Single-family homes, Duplexes


    Average Home Prices in the Clearlake Park

    * Buying: $350,000 – $475,000

    * Renting: $1,600 – $2,200/month



    Heron Point



    Heron Point

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Heron Point is a secluded enclave featuring custom modern homes and a tranquil atmosphere. It's suitable for individuals seeking privacy and a connection with nature.



    Characteristics of the Heron Point

    * Culture: Nature appreciation with conservation-focused residents

    * Transportation: Car necessary, located on a gravel road

    * Services: Very limited; relies on main town for amenities

    * Environment: Quiet, wooded, and serene


    Housing Options in the Heron Point

    Custom-built homes, Eco-friendly houses


    Average Home Prices in the Heron Point

    * Buying: $450,000 – $700,000

    * Renting: $2,000 – $3,000/month
